The iexplorer.exe file is installed and used by browser hijacker CoolWebSearch.time. It is also related to other parasites such as worm W32.HLLW.Cult.H and worm W32.HLLW.Gaobot.AZ. Usually, iexplorer.exe runs a process of the same name. This process should be killed and the iexplorer.exe file deleted immediately after detection to ensure system stability and security.
